Nancy N. Artus is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Biotechnology. According to data from OpenAlex, Nancy N. Artus has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 704 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Plant Science, 9 papers in Molecular Biology and 2 papers in Biotechnology. Recurrent topics in Nancy N. Artus’s work include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(8 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(5 papers) and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(3 papers). Nancy N. Artus is often cited by papers focused on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(8 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(5 papers) and Plant nutrient uptake and metabolism (3 papers). Nancy N. Artus coll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Japan. Nancy N. Artus's co-authors include Sarah J. Gilmour, Michael F. Thomashow, Peter L. Steponkus, Matsuo Uemura, Chentao Lin, Gerald E. Edwards, Margareta Ryberg, Christer Sundqvist, George H. Lorimer and Shauna Somerville and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LANT PHYSIOLOGY and FEBS Letters.
